Boilerless operation: DIP 1.7 provides selection of
boilerless operation. In boilerless mode, the compressor is
only used for heating when LT1 is above the temperature
specified by the setting of DIP 1.8. Below DIP 1.8 setting,
the compressor is not used and the control goes into
emergency heat mode, staging on EH1 and EH2 to
provide heating.
On = normal. Off = Boilerless operation.
1.8 –
Boilerless changeover temperature: DIP 1.8 provides
selection of boilerless changeover temperature setpoint.
Note that the LT1 thermistor is sensing refrigerant
temperature between the coaxial heat exchanger and
the expansion device (TXV). Therefore, the 50°F [10°C]
setting is not 50°F [10°C] water, but approximately 60°F
[16°C] EWT.
On = 50°F [10°C]. Off = 40°F [16°C].

2.7 –
Auto dehumidification fan mode or high fan mode:
DIP 2.7 provides selection of auto dehumidification fan
mode or high fan mode. In auto dehumidification mode,
the fan speed relay will remain off during cooling stage 2
IF the H input is active. In high fan mode, the fan enable
and fan speed relays will turn on when the H input is
active.
On = Auto dehumidification mode (default). Off = High fan
mode.
2.8 –
Special factory selection: DIP 2.8 provides special
factory selection. Normal position is “On”. Do not change
selection unless instructed to do so by the factory.

DIP Package #3 has 4 switches and provides the
following setup and operating selections:
3.1 –
Communications configuration: DIP 3.1 provides
selection of the DXM2 operation in a communicating
system. The DXM2 may operate as the Master of certain
network configurations. In most configurations the DXM2
will operate as a master device.
On = Communicating Master device (default). Off =
communicating
Subordinate
device.
3.2 –
HWG Test Mode: DIP 3.2 provides forced operation
of the HWG pump output, activating the HWG pump
output for up to five minutes.
On = HWG test mode. Off = Normal HWG mode (default).
3.3 –
HWG Temperature: DIP 3.3 provides the selection
of the HWG operating setpoint.
On = 150°F [66°C]. Off = 125°F [52°C] (default).
3.4 –
HWG Status: DIP 3.4 provides HWG operation
control.
On = HWG mode enabled. Off = HWG mode disabled
(default).
